A super DDS makes sure that the Lively drug is accessible at the internet site of motion for the suitable length of your time, whilst ideally not exhibiting any physiological influence itself. The DDS must aim to supply drug concentrations at the website of motion that are previously mentioned the small efficient concentration but underneath the maximal tolerated plasma focus (small toxic focus) (Determine 2.1). Things that Management the drug focus incorporate the route of administration, the frequency of administration, the metabolism on the drug and its clearance costs, and importantly, the dosage kind style and design by itself.

In this method of getting sustained release from an oral dosage sort, drug is combined with an inert or hydrophobic polymer after which you can compressed in to a pill. Sustained release is created resulting from the fact that the dissolving drug has diffused by way of a community of channels that exist in between compacted polymer particles.

The advantages contain decrease dosing, lowered side effects and noncompliance. The down sides are decreased availability in emergencies rather than all drugs are appropriate candidates. Drugs selected must have short 50 %-lives, undergo hepatic metabolism or have solubility/absorption challenges necessitating numerous doses day by day.

A capsule is a device reliable dosage kind in which the drug parts are enclosed in the soluble shell. Capsules assist to mask the uncomfortable flavor of its contents and the drug has constrained conversation With all the excipients. Capsules are labeled into two types: Challenging-shelled capsules, which are accustomed to encapsulate dry, powdered parts; tender-shelled capsules, principally utilized for hydrophobic drugs and oily Energetic substances that happen to be suspended or dissolved in oil. Lozenges are chewable strong unit dosage kinds, where by the drug is loaded inside a caramel base designed up of sugar and gum; the latter presents cohesiveness and strength for the lozenge and enables sluggish release on the drug.
